summaryrefslogtreecommitdiff
path: root/src/core/hle/kernel
diff options
context:
space:
mode:
authorRodrigo Locatti <reinuseslisp@airmail.cc>2020-11-08 19:11:31 -0300
committerGitHub <noreply@github.com>2020-11-08 19:11:31 -0300
commit8008b5ddc96dc129acec59f945c9bcce285c43a5 (patch)
tree14fb629c96e2c091be2c800f13dc8aff67eeb79f /src/core/hle/kernel
parent7bf9f9ae49f173ecbdd18c20aa69a1a2c2e9c5f4 (diff)
parentda7be67dafc90c84529304cfef57dfa5f9291017 (diff)
Merge pull request #4910 from lioncash/service
ipc_helpers: Remove usage of the global system instance
Diffstat (limited to 'src/core/hle/kernel')
-rw-r--r--src/core/hle/kernel/hle_ipc.h6
1 files changed, 6 insertions, 0 deletions
diff --git a/src/core/hle/kernel/hle_ipc.h b/src/core/hle/kernel/hle_ipc.h
index f3277b766..c31a65476 100644
--- a/src/core/hle/kernel/hle_ipc.h
+++ b/src/core/hle/kernel/hle_ipc.h
@@ -24,6 +24,10 @@ namespace Core::Memory {
class Memory;
}
+namespace IPC {
+class ResponseBuilder;
+}
+
namespace Service {
class ServiceFrameworkBase;
}
@@ -287,6 +291,8 @@ public:
}
private:
+ friend class IPC::ResponseBuilder;
+
void ParseCommandBuffer(const HandleTable& handle_table, u32_le* src_cmdbuf, bool incoming);
std::array<u32, IPC::COMMAND_BUFFER_LENGTH> cmd_buf;